How to turn on the call to grow louder on Android 10

Android 10 brings a lot of useful features, among them is Vibrate first then ring intellig. This feature will set the sound mode when an incoming call does not disturb others when you are in public or in the office. When someone calls the device will vibrate to notify you, then the new call sound gradually increases the volume but not at the default volume level as previous Android versions. This feature was previously available on Pixel 2, Pixel 3, Pixel 3a and Pixel 4. phones.

Instructions to turn on Vibrate first then ring on Android 10

We access the Settings, select Sound and then Vibrate for calls . In the next interface there will be the option to set the vibration mode when an incoming call, click Vibrate first then ring gradullay in the list is done.

When the phone calls, it will first vibrate for about 5 seconds to signal to the user. Then the ringtone volume will increase gradually in about 10 seconds. The volume level of the increased ringtone will not exceed the maximum volume limit set by your device sound system.
